    It's not advised to do another OS install over an existing one, but this should be able to help you achieve what you want:
    https://forums.mydigitallife.net/threads/78147

    All 17763.1 LTSC ISO's contain both, N and non N editions, 17763.107 LTSC (re-release iso's) only contain non N editions, But 17763.316 LTSC refresh iso's contain both N and non N editions again.

    It's also not advised to use N editons.
